Publisher's Summary

One of the nation's best-known rabbis offers an engaging lecture that focuses on bringing shalom into your home. Rabbi Boteach touches on themes from his TLC television program Shalom in the Home and discusses parenting and the family, marriage and intimacy, and other issues. Audience members ask about specific problems facing their families.

Rabbi Shmuley Boteach was named by Talkers magazine as one of the 100 most important radio hosts in America. He is the author of 15 books and is an acclaimed syndicated columnist who in 2005 won the American Jewish Press Association's highest award for commentary.

A long-respected member of the Jewish intellectual community appears in this episode of Live at the 92nd Street Y. Rabbi Shmuley Boteach has had his own television program, his own column, and now he is answering audience questions about life, love, and Judaism. Boteach is, as always, a charismatic and engaging speaker. His advice is marked by compassion and wit and it's clear that he is truly listening to each of the audience members who approach him for wisdom.
